How to solve
Replace each variable with its value in parentheses, then evaluate carefully.
Steps
- Put the value in parentheses where the variable was.
- Evaluate powers first, then products, then sums.
- Watch signs on negative substitutions.
Example
Evaluate 2x² − 3x at x = −2.
- 2(−2)² − 3(−2).
- 2·4 + 6 = 14.
Answer: 14
